EXCEEDS logo
Exceeds
yoguo

PROFILE

Yoguo

Worked extensively on the virt-s1/os-tests repository, delivering robust enhancements to cloud infrastructure testing and automation. Focused on improving reliability, security, and observability, this developer implemented features such as OCI and AliCloud resource management, automated disk hotplug testing, and RPM signature verification modernization. Leveraging Python, Bash, and Shell scripting, they addressed kernel management, FIPS compliance, and network configuration challenges, ensuring consistent test execution across diverse environments. Their approach emphasized CI/CD stability, precise logging, and resilient system integration, reducing flaky failures and deployment risks. The work demonstrated depth in debugging, system administration, and test automation, supporting scalable, cloud-native validation workflows.

Overall Statistics

Feature vs Bugs

31%Features

Repository Contributions

20Total
Bugs
11
Commits
20
Features
5
Lines of code
1,188
Activity Months11

Work History

March 2026

3 Commits • 1 Features

Mar 1, 2026

March 2026 performance highlights: Expanded OCI testing coverage and hardened FIPS-mode boot handling within the virt-s1/os-tests framework. Delivered OCI configuration, provisioning scaffolding, and resource management capabilities for VMs and storage, including attach/detach operations for block devices and NICs in OCI. Fixed boot partition UUID retrieval under FIPS mode by aligning the retrieval to the actual boot device, reducing boot-related failures in secure deployments. These changes broaden cloud validation, improve reliability for OCI and FIPS scenarios, and demonstrate end-to-end cloud-testing and provisioning capabilities.

October 2025

1 Commits

Oct 1, 2025

Month: 2025-10 — Focused on reliability improvement in auto-registration flow for virt-s1/os-tests. Replaced output parsing with return-status check of subscription-manager status (0 indicates success) inside enable_auto_registration, reducing flakiness in CI and deployed environments. The change was implemented via the patch that applies the commit "Fix subscription-manager status return status" (commit hash c28e17c5d612b06104c52b203b3659e85651e314).

September 2025

1 Commits • 1 Features

Sep 1, 2025

September 2025 monthly summary for virt-s1/os-tests: Delivered AliCloud Disk Hotplug Support and AlibabaVolume Attach/Detach Integration, enabling automated hotplug testing on AliCloud and improved storage lifecycle management. Refactored disk creation, deletion, attachment, and detachment flows to ensure correct VM state transitions, and added attach_block and detach_block methods for AlibabaVolume to facilitate seamless AliCloud storage integration. Included commit 38cc809c834fd63d20fba7e4c0eb678b6e891f0e with message 'Support to run disk hotplug test on AliCloud' to support end-to-end testing on AliCloud.

August 2025

1 Commits

Aug 1, 2025

August 2025 monthly summary for virt-s1/os-tests: Focused on RPM signature verification modernization to align with RPM v4 standards, improving security, reliability, and packaging conformance. Updated tests to verify RSAHEADER signatures to reflect current RPM packaging expectations and reduce signature-related build risks.

June 2025

1 Commits • 1 Features

Jun 1, 2025

June 2025 monthly summary for virt-s1/os-tests emphasizing observability improvements. Delivered a targeted logging enhancement by adding a new log message identifier 'msg_265' to the baseline logging system, enabling more precise event tracking and faster debugging across test runs. Change was implemented via a single commit (Add msg_265 to baseline_log) and aligns with the team’s observability and reliability goals.

May 2025

1 Commits

May 1, 2025

May 2025—virt-s1/os-tests: Focused on stability and reliability improvements in the test harness. No new features delivered this month. Major bug fix outlined below.

March 2025

2 Commits • 2 Features

Mar 1, 2025

March 2025: Os-tests monthly summary focusing on reliability and observability. Delivered resilience in image mode testing and improved debugging capabilities, reducing flaky test behavior and accelerating root-cause analysis for cloud image verification workflows.

February 2025

2 Commits

Feb 1, 2025

February 2025 monthly summary focusing on stability and reliability improvements in the virt-s1/os-tests framework. Delivered two critical bug fixes that enhance network test robustness and OSTree image mode kernel/initramfs path discovery, resulting in more deterministic CI feedback and fewer flaky tests. Demonstrated strong debugging, test harness resilience, and cross-cutting system-path handling.

January 2025

1 Commits

Jan 1, 2025

January 2025 monthly summary for virt-s1/os-tests focused on FIPS compliance for RHEL10 image mode. Delivered a robust fix to enable FIPS across all RHEL image types by adding a conditional path for ostree-based images to use rpm-ostree kargs, while preserving grubby for non-ostree systems. This ensures FIPS is consistently enabled across image modes and reduces risk of misconfiguration.

December 2024

1 Commits

Dec 1, 2024

December 2024 monthly summary for virt-s1/os-tests focused on stabilizing kernel parameter handling across image mode for ostree vs non-ostree systems. Delivered a robust fix to ensure kernel parameters are appended and removed correctly in image mode, with conditional logic selecting rpm-ostree kargs for ostree systems and grubby for non-ostree systems. Improved teardown cleanup to reliably identify and remove added arguments, reducing boot-time configuration drift and deployment risk.

November 2024

6 Commits

Nov 1, 2024

Monthly summary for 2024-11 focusing on virt-s1/os-tests: Delivered stability and reliability improvements across the test suite with targeted fixes to image mode tests, test data workflows, and environment handling. The changes reduced false negatives and improved CI determinism, enabling faster feedback and more trustworthy release readiness.

Activity

Loading activity data...

Quality Metrics

Correctness84.6%
Maintainability84.0%
Architecture76.0%
Performance73.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

BashPythonShell

Technical Skills

API integrationAWSAutomationCI/CDCloud ComputingDebuggingDevOpsKernel ManagementLinuxLinux AdministrationLinux KernelLoggingNetwork ConfigurationNetwork TestingPython Scripting

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

virt-s1/os-tests

Nov 2024 Mar 2026
11 Months active

Languages Used

BashPythonShell

Technical Skills

CI/CDLinuxNetwork TestingPython ScriptingShell ScriptingStorage Testing